Mike, this has gotten me to thinking to the DEF systems have any filters or pumps that will need to be maintained.



The current Chassis Cab trucks have a total of 5 filters and screens. Most of the problems have been related to low flow. Most technicians only are checking the filter.
 
There is a pump. A heater element on the 13s that is destroyed by any type of hydrocarbons. The earlier c/c's used heated lines. There are many dtc's for the scr system and some will keep the truck from starting. Usually get about 200 mile warning first
